What is CCS?
Cargo Community System (CCS) is an institution typically organized on national
bases. CCSs usually are established with the help of national airline, but stay
independent and neutral, representing various parties of air cargo industry.
The main mission of CCS is to function as the multilingual communication
channel between the parties in full compliance with the international standards
(UN, IATA, FIATA, CCC) of the industry. This means that CCS is the connection
tool and platform that integrates all the parties (Forwarding Agents, Airlines,
Handling Agents, GSAs, Local Authorities) with each other directly or via means
of standard message exchange, acting as a transmitter. In this case CCS translates
all received EDI messages sent by different standards and distributes them among
relevant parties in the appropriate formats.
National CCS’s task is also to provide solution for those parties who do not have
automated system of their own to join this channel.
With this, national CCS helps to achieve the final goal which is the „accurate” and
„paperless” air cargo transportation.

Airlines:
- receive FWB (master air waybill data), FHL (house air waybill data) and FFR (reservation
request) standard IATA messages, no need of manual entry (no user interface)
- FSR/FSA status information exchange instead of phone contact with forwarders
- FVR/FVA schedule information exchange instead of phone contact with forwarders
- IP connection can be set up to save SITA costs
Handling agents:
- receiving FWB (master air waybill data), FHL (house air waybill data) standard IATA
messages, no need of manual entry (no user interface)
- IP connection can be set up to save SITA costs
- if they serve shippers directly they can also use CCS Hungary AWB software to issue an
AWB, print bar-coded labels and making reservations to airlines
Airline representatives, GSAs:
- built-in database (IATA tariffs, airport and city codes, carriers)
- SITA telex communication center to communicate with their represented airlines by telex
- a tool to receive copy of FFM, FFR, FSU messages from handling agents and forwarders
Small airports:
- a cheap replacement for online SITATEX workstation to send and receive SITA teletype
messages

IATA standard messaging
The CCS Hungary Air Forwarding system has been developed to be
capable to receive and to send the latest and previously released IATA
standard messages. This makes the system to connect to any kind of
systems in the air industry with standard messaging.
The messaging structure and messages types can be seen later.
Types of IATA standard FSA/FSU messages which are not detailed later:
•
•
•
•
•
•
•
•
•
FSU/BKD – shipment has been booked
FSU/AWD – documents of shipment has been received
FSU/RCF – shipment has been received at the airport
FSU/MAN – shipment has been manifested
FSU/DEP – shipment has departed
FSU/NFD – consignee has been notified
FSU/DLV – shipment has been delivered to consignee
FSU/RCT – shipment has been received from another line
FSU/TFD – shipment has been transferred to another carrier

Issue an AWB by IATA standards
From the system anyone can issue a IATA standard full MAWB or a HAWB within
1 minutes.
The system helps and control the user to issue a correct AWB with user help,
mandatory and optional fields, autorating, built-in IATA rate database and other
IATA codes and also with masks. There is also a great visual help for users. When
they fill the boxes on the AWB creating window, the system shows to him/her on
the right side of window , the picture of neutral AWB and the field which was
entered with data. Into this AWB picture can be opened the help function for user.
All the information in red defines the mandatory fields, and clicking on line the
system takes the user to the given field.
After the user sent out the reservation the system puts all the data (routing, pieces
and weight, description of goods and special handling codes) from the reservation
to the AWB appropriate fields. Above it the user only needs to fill in the shipper,
consignee and also notify fields, and put on the AWB the other charges with
autocost module.
The AWB creating window is separated by functions:
1. Entering the shipper, consignee and also notify fields: on this tab the user can
enter all the possible customer data
2. Routing, currency and payment mode: user can check or modify the routing of
the shipment and the payment method (in default MAWB is PP, HAWB is CC)
Issue an AWB by IATA standards
3. Autorating: when user enters the weight and pieces of shipment the system
automatically calculates the freight cost by using IATA rates to the given
destination and airlines. On this tab also there is the possibility for the ULD and
RCP rating. The user can also choose the necessary corates or surcharges from the
built-in database. The chargeable weight can be calculated and entered by the
system after the user entered the dimensions. Of course users can built up an
other charges database as well and with the Autocost button they can put them
onto the AWB.
4. Other information: on this tab the user can enter information to general
information fields (e.g.: accounting information, under tariffs, handling
information). Also on this tab can be entered the special handling codes of
shipment.
5. Issuing details: every field is filled in on this tab with the already entered basic
data. Of course user can modify it in case of need.
6. Manifest information: on this tab all the HAWBs of the given MAWB or the
MAWB of the given HAWB can be viewed and opened.
After filling in the AWB in the header of the window there are different function
for the user, such as Save&Print, Save and Load mask and Save as picture.
When user print out the AWB he/she can choose that he print it to a laser printer
or a dot printer. For even faster issuing AWB the AWB data can be saved to a
mask, which mask next time can be loaded.
Also if user want to e-mail the AWB to his/her partner, it can be saved as a picture
to the desktop.
